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Type: Different soil types can impact the difficulty and time required for excavation.
- Tank Size: Larger tanks require more extensive excavation, increasing costs.
- Depth of Excavation: Deeper excavations are more labor-intensive and costly.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Accessibility of Site: Difficult-to-reach sites may incur additional charges.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Ellensburg can affect overall cost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Ellensburg, WA) |
---|---|
Initial Site Inspection | $100 - $200 |
Soil Testing | $300 - $500 |
Excavation (per cubic yard) | $50 - $75 |
Installation of Sewer Tank |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Permit Fees | $150 - $300 |
Final Inspection | $100 - $200 |
